Our Foundation

// A Guiding Verse — Micah 6:8 (ESV)

"He has told you, O man, what is good; and what does the Lord require of you but to do justice, and to love kindness, and to walk humbly with your God?"

Micah 6:8 — English Standard Version

Built on
More than Engineering

At Pitzer Engineering, we believe technical excellence and integrity should go hand in hand.

Our business exists not only to provide engineering services, but also to serve others faithfully through honesty, humility, diligence, and genuine care for the people we work with.

While we serve customers from all backgrounds and beliefs — and welcome the opportunity to work with anyone who needs capable, trustworthy engineering support — our company is ultimately grounded in the teachings of Jesus Christ and the conviction that people matter more than projects.

We strive to reflect these principles in the way we communicate, solve problems, and build relationships with customers, coworkers, and partners.

Principles in Practice

⚖️

Do Justice

We deal fairly with every client, every vendor, and every person on a job site. We give honest assessments even when the honest answer is harder to hear. We don't inflate scope, hide problems, or oversell solutions.

🤝

Love Kindness

Engineering projects are stressful. We try to be the calm, steady presence in the room — responsive, patient, and genuinely interested in helping people succeed. The relationship matters, not just the deliverable.

🙏

Walk Humbly

We don't pretend to know everything. When we're outside our depth, we say so. When we make a mistake, we own it and fix it. Humility keeps us learning and keeps our clients' trust intact.

🔍

Honesty in All Things

If your system doesn't need a full replacement, we'll tell you. If a project is beyond our current capability, we'll refer you to someone who can help. Honesty builds the kind of trust that leads to long-term relationships.

💪

Diligent Work

We take our work seriously. Deadlines, documentation quality, follow-through on commitments — these aren't negotiable. We bring the same attention to a small troubleshooting call as we do to a large capital project.

❤️

Genuine Care

We care about the outcome for the people on the other end of the project — the operators who run the system daily, the maintenance techs who have to work on it at 2 AM, the managers who are counting on it to run.
